


Dodital Darwa Pass trek is one of the best ways to escape to a fairy tale world by trekking in the Garhwal region of Uttrakhand. The main highlight of this trek is Dodital lake which is located at an elevation of 3310 m. above the sea level; and Darwa pass top which is located at an elevation of 4150 m.
Apart from the high altitude lake, you get to see a wide variety of flora and fauna, crystal clear water, dense alpine forests, tranquil surroundings, splendid view of Himalayan ranges, gurgling streams and much more.The trek covers places like Haridwar, Sangam Chatti, Bhevra, Dodital, Darwa Pass top and Uttarkashi.
The difficulty level of the trek is easy to moderate. The best time to go for Dodital Darwa Pass trek is from April to November.

Day 1 of your Dodital Darwa Pass trek starts with a 7hour drive from Haridwar to Sangam Chatti, via Uttarkashi.
The distance between the two is roughly 175 km. We take a halt in between for refreshments and lunch. The drive passes by Mussoorie bypass road which is very scenic.
Enjoy the drive as you pass by snow covered meadows, pine trees and majestic view of Himalayas. On the way, you can see the beautiful Tehri dam Lake. The drive from Uttarkashi to Sangam Chatti is approximately 15 km.
Sangam Chatti is located at an elevation of 1828 m. above the sea level. It is a small quaintvillage market place where you can enjoy shopping. This is the starting point of your trek. Your overnight stay is arranged at the guest house in Sangam Chatti.
Get up early in the morning, have breakfast and put on your backpacks to move ahead towards Bhevra. We recommend some morning exercise before beginning the trek as the distance to be travelled is quite long.
The day starts with a 14 km. trek from Sangam Chatti to Agoda village and further to Bhevra. It takes around 5 to 6 hours of climb and walk to cover this distance. From Sangam Chatti, you have to cross the bridge over a small stream, to begin the trek to Agoda village. The climb towards Agoda village is not very steep.
However, the climb from Agoda village to Bhevra is a gradual trail witnessing some tea shacks and ample of lodges.Bhevra gate is located at a distance of 2 km. from the Agoda village. Bhevra is a picturesque place located at an altitude of 2500 m. above the sea level.
Enjoy overnight stay in a tent under the open sky amidst vibrant and majestic landscapes.
After having delicious breakfast in the morning, we start our day with a trek from Bhevra to Dodital. The stretch is around 5 to 6 hours of trekking distance. The trail goes up steadily through the damp forests high above the Asi Ganga, making way through oak, pine, rhododendron and bamboo forests.
The flora and fauna of the place are very rich. Doditalis located at an altitude of 3310 m. above the sea level. Dodital Lake is one of the main highlights of this trek. This beautiful, fresh and crystal clear water Lake is a feast for the eyes.
This place has a lot to offer you, right from serene rivers, beautiful lakes, murmuring waterfalls, mountains to rising Himalayan peaks. Set up a camp beside the lake and enjoy the night camping in this alluring and peaceful place.
Do you know?: As per Hindu mythology, Dodital is the birth place of Lord Ganeshaandhe chose to abode here. This place also has a temple dedicated to him.
After some refreshments, start early morning for Dodital to Darwa Pass top trek. Towards the day end, head back to Dodital for night stay. The stretch is around 6 to 7 hours of trekking distance.
Darwa Pass top is located at an altitude of 4150 m. above the sea level, which gives a great opportunity to thrill seekers to go well over this altitude. As you move through the trek, you can witness the change in vegetation and atmosphere. Feel the breeze and peace of the place.
You have to climb uphill through the dense forest, and meadows dusted with snow. The trekking trail is a bit steep and long but has some stunning sights. Witness the amazing view of majestic snow-capped Himalayan ranges, Bandarpunch Peak, Swargarohini Range, Chaukhamba from the top. Cherish and relax at the Darwa Pass top and then head back to Dodital.
Experience the fun of rolling down the steep hill on your way back. On reaching Dodital, pitch your tent at the winsome site. Be prepared for snow anytime as this place experiences a lot of snow during this time.
Early morning post breakfast, start Dodital to Bhevra trek. The total time required for today’s trek is 4 to 5 hours. The climb from Bhevra to Dodital took 5 to 6 hours on day 3, but this is going to be an easy day, as you trek back to Bhevra, which is a downhill trekking trail.
The entire view along the trek is quite mesmerising and soothing. Make sure you click good pictures around this extremely peaceful place. Rhododendron tree line will start to fade as you trek from Dodital to Bhevra.
On reaching Bhevra, enjoy some local delicacies of the place like jhangora ki kheer or gahat rasmi badi which is like Kofta. Your overnight stay is arranged in tents.
The sixth day of your trek starts with early morning breakfast then you trek from Bhevra toroad head. This is a downhill trek and hence very easy. The small trek is going to be over within few hours. Once you reach the road head, our team member drives you back to Uttarkashi.
During the drive enjoy the beautiful surroundings. You can see small markets along the route where you can shop or try the local food. After arrival at Uttarkashi, visit Nehru Institute of Mountaineering and Vishwanath temple.
Later take the dinner and proceed for an overnight stay in the hotel.
This is the last day of the tour. Start your day with morning breakfast and then proceed to checkout from the hotel. Later drive from Uttarkashi to Haridwar. The journey distance is 190 km. which takes around 6 hours of drive.
After reaching Haridwar, head towards your onward destination via train or bus.

Chardham Yatra 2026 – Opening- The Chardham Yatra 2026 is expected to run from April to November 2026, with the temples opening on Akshaya Tritiya: Yamunotri (April 19), Gangotri (April 19), Kedarnath (April 22), and Badrinath (April 24). The pilgrimage season concludes around Bhai Dooj (late October/early November).
For the safety and smooth management of devotees, mandatory online registration is required. Pilgrims should be prepared for the challenging Himalayan terrain, and both helicopter and road travel options are available. Health checks are advised, especially for elderly pilgrims, to ensure a safe and fulfilling spiritual journey.

Kagbhushudi Lake trek has lately garnered a lot of attention among the famous trekking sites. The lake is located in the Garhwal Himalayas of Uttarakhand (Dev Bhoomi), near Mana village, close to Badrinath.”
Kagbhushundi Ji is one of the most profound and mystical figures in the Ramcharitmanas. He represents timeless devotion (bhakti) and is deeply associated with Lord Shiva and the eternal narration of the Ram Katha.
In Uttarkand of the Ramcharitmanas, after Doha 61, the subsequent chaupais describe the dialogue between Sage Kakbhushundi and Garuda. These verses narrate:
"उत्तर दिसि सुंदर गिरि नीला। तहँ रह काकभुसुण्डि सुसीला॥"
According to the Ramcharitmanas, Lord Shiva directed Garuda to Sage Kakbhushundi and said that he continuously narrates the sacred story of Lord Shri Ramachandra. Birds of many noble kinds listen to this divine narration with deep reverence. By hearing it, the sorrow born of delusion would be removed. Following Lord Shiva’s guidance, Garuda went to the place where Sage Kakbhushundi lived, endowed with unwavering wisdom and perfect devotion. On beholding that mountain, Garuda’s heart was filled with joy, and all illusion, attachment, and anxiety vanished merely by its sight. There, aged birds had gathered to listen to the beautiful deeds of Lord Rama. On seeing that supremely pure hermitage itself, all of Garuda’s delusion, doubts, and various confusions were completely dispelled.
This section of Uttarkand forms the scriptural basis for the spiritual significance of the Kakbhushundi region and trek in the Garhwal Himalayas.
The Kagbhushundi Lake Trek is not only an adventure but also a spiritual journey. It is associated with Kakbhushundi Ji, the immortal crow-form devotee of Lord Rama, who resides on Neelkanth Mountain and has narrated the Ram Katha to Garuda Ji. Pilgrims and trekkers alike visit this sacred site to experience the divine energy, devotion, and serene Himalayan surroundings.
